92-93 GSR suspension into 90crxsi
Hey...I have this same question, only I have a 90 Dx.
I'm going to be swapping in the suspension from a 92 GS-R, and I want to upgrade my shocks/springs to a set of Omnipower Streets...which application should I order them for, CRX or Integra? Should I also swap LCA's? What about sway bars? I have the whole car at my disposal, so everything I can use I am going to. Thanks

It should all bolt up the same as doing the LS suspension. You should still use the shocks and springs for a CRX.
All you should need from the DA is the front knuckles, caliper, and rotors ( maybe brake lines if you want but not necessary). Take the whole rear suspension ( whole trailing arm w/ caliper and rotor). Also take the master cylinder and proportioning valve.
Your CRX should already have rear disk, so take the Tegs and sell them. You can use the front knuckles to have bigger brakes( bolts right up) but need to get an alignment afterwards. Replace the MC with the integra one so your brake pedal isnt so mushy.

hey, I have an 1988 dx HB with 93 gsr Brake all the way around. as for the struts, I use 92-95 Civic up front( changed out the fork) and 89-91 civic rears. the coilovers I use are for my car, if you use the ones for a integra the spring rate will be too high. As for the Master cylinder and brake booster, I was using the integra, but I just swapped them for a set off of an 91 prelude Si and they work great. In case you where wondering I am using the PV off of a 91 CRX Si, so far things are great.
